In this chapter we show you how to put to use the Java integration techniques introduced in the previous chapter. We do this by providing step-by-step examples of adding functionality to the sample Sales Tracking application that we first introduced in Chapter 2.
First we discuss hybrid techniques used in the two samples where we add functionality for searching and pagination in portlets.
Then we discuss full Java integration techniques, from the simple "HelloWorldFromDominoServer" portlet, to using JavaBeans in a portlet, and creating an ACL browsing portlet for Domino. We also demonstrate how to use logging (log4j) in a portlet and how to get started with Object pooling.
